A Night Park of Zoo Animals and Light

The highlight of the summer at Non Hoi Park, the Night Zoo once again features plenty of events. This year, the lesser panda and owl exhibits will make their Night Zoo debut! The Night Museum has also leveled up with a production of lights and sounds that are sure to make your heart pound. During the Night Zoo, amusement park rides are unlimited. Other fun events include a Hoshizora Gourmet Garden with an enhanced selection of food, street performances that further liven up the Night Zoo, projection mapping, and more. This summer, plunge into a night safari and enjoy exhilarating new experiences!

■ Night ZOO

The animals at night are a bit different!? You may be able to see animals unique to Night ZOO, such as the fantastic lion and the cool giraffe that stand in the zoo after sunset!

■ Real Night Jungle

The popular Real Night Jungle has evolved! You can enjoy the excitement with collaboration of colorful tropical plants and limited-time illuminations and sounds.

■ Night ZOO Exploration Kit

With the illuminated pendant and exploration map in hand, come and solve dinosaur riddles! Receive an original present when you reach the goal.
[Start] In front of the Main Gate and East Gate (Sales 5:00 PM-6:30 PM) [Goal] Hiroba in front of the Museum of Natural History (Goal 6:30 PM-8:30 PM)
[Capacity] 500 people each day
[Fee] 500 yen

ACCESS

  • Access by public transport
    Access by public transport
    ・From Toyohashi Station, take the JR Tokaido line. Alight at Futagawa station and walk approx. 6 min. from the south exit.
  • Access by car
    Access by car
    ・Drive for approx. 50 minutes on National Route 1 in the direction of Shizuoka from Otowa Gamagori I.C. on the Tomei Expressway and turn right at the "Doshokubutsuen Iriguchi" intersection.
    ・Drive for approx. 10 minutes on Nationa Route 151 in the direction of Kozakai from Toyokawa I.C. on the Tomei Expressway Toyokawa. After turning left at the Miyashita intersection, continue on National Route 1 in the direction of Shizuoka for approx. 30 min. and turn right at the "Doshokubutsuen Iriguchi" intersection.
